Brooke Robertson is a Louisiana-based singer/songwriter who grew up riding horses and four wheelers. She started singing as a pre-teen and has been singing ever since. Her debut album, Taking My Voice Back, released earlier this year and marks the first time she has shared her story as a victim of childhood sexual abuse. Brooke joins pop sensibilities and country soulfulness together with her pure vocal tone and heartfelt lyrics, crafting songs centered on the way God's redemption weaves its way through all our life experiences – both heartache and hope. Brooke joins me to talk about her new album, Taking My Voice Back. We chat about how she got started in music. She shares about how she had a plan for her life and how God closed that door. Brooke tells us that when she didn't have a plan B, she became completely dependent on God to define her path. She says, "you don't really fully understand what trust mean until you're having to walk through something that's difficult." Brooke tells us that after her first tour, when it was time to write new music, she asked God what people needed to hear. He answered that it was time for her to share her story of being the victim of abuse. She had buried this story deep inside and was reluctant to share it with anyone, and certainly didn't feel ready to share it with the world. Brooke and I talk about forgiveness and how she felt the need to reach out to the person who hurt her 15 years before. She was able to offer forgiveness and share Jesus. She encourages anyone who is holding on to something painful to try and find healing.
